Transaction 654041dca3ef9040ed0584d38f7bd591820ef16e5cfd6ebc3721558c4f743326
1 Input
2 Outputs
- 654041dca3ef9040ed0584d38f7bd591820ef16e5cfd6ebc3721558c4f743326:0
- 654041dca3ef9040ed0584d38f7bd591820ef16e5cfd6ebc3721558c4f743326:1
value 4500000
address 1Y7NuX7iFyNMxj2FZ8qzWZQHHh5GUJR6g
value 152755920
address 162gdspPPwYwTQJhUBSyDm8asWjjxm1yE6